Local Water Quality
Elk Grove draws from Sacramento River surface water and local groundwater — hardness in the hard range around 7 GPG. The city has grown dramatically and has a large inventory of 10–20 year old pools now entering the prime remodeling window. Calcium scaling on tile and gradual plaster wear are common findings throughout the city.
Local Climate
Elk Grove has a hot Sacramento Valley climate — July highs average around 96°F with peak days regularly reaching 103–108°F. The flat valley floor location provides no topographic relief from the summer heat. Winters are mild with lows around 39°F and occasional dense tule fog.
Elk Grove's flat valley location and hot summers drive significant evaporation and thermal stress on pool surfaces — comparable to the Central Valley. Hard water combined with Valley heat produces the same degradation patterns we see throughout the Central Valley. Elk Grove is an active and growing pool remodeling market.

Elk Grove's water averages approximately 120 ppm (7.0 GPG) — classified as hard. This affects how quickly calcium scaling develops on tile and how long pool plaster surfaces last.
Basic replastering starts around $5,000–$10,000. Full remodels with new tile, coping, skimmer installs, and mastic work typically range from $15,000–$40,000+. We offer free estimates with no obligation.
Most projects take 1–3 weeks. A basic replaster takes 5–7 days. Full remodels typically take 2–3 weeks depending on scope.
